**Build Provenance: Ledgerling billing worker blue-green deploys**

For the weekly sync: every Ledgerling blue-green cutover now records the signed artifact digest, builder identity, and source revision before traffic shifts. Green receives mirrored traffic for ten minutes prior to promotion. The most recent promoted build carries the provenance token below.

build token for yajof-bajof: htk31_506ff1188f74596b5bb2eec94edc43c

# Building Access: Cleaning Crew — Harlowe Point

The contracted cleaning crew from Drayfield Services works 18:00–22:00, Monday to Friday. They enter via the loading bay door and sign the facilities log on arrival and departure. Crew supervisors carry their own fobs; relief staff do not. If a relief cleaner arrives without a fob, the facilities desk should admit them using the code below.

staff pass of kawip-hawef = bdg-QLP-2

### Step 4: Enable Offline Mode

Fieldling plugins must bundle their schema cache for offline survey capture. Set `offline: true` in the plugin manifest, precompile form definitions, and verify sync-queue replay against the staging collector. Plugins without a valid cache are rejected at install. Sign your plugin bundle before submission using the distribution key provided here:

release key, kahif-yagap: bky3_1JN

#
# Quick context for the Pinemont release: we never hard-delete order rows.
# The Cartwheel checkout service sets deleted_at, and a nightly sweeper in
# Burrowjobs purges anything past the retention window. If you shrink the
# window, refunds older than it will 404 in support tooling, and Talia's
# team will come asking. Grace periods and batch sizes were tuned after
# the March sweeper incident, so change with care. The constants that
# govern sweep timing and purge batching follow.

constants for bawif-kawif:
QUOTAS = {
    "ulaael": 5,
    "holael": 10,
}